Job Description
The Financial Compliance Manager serves as a key member of the Advancement division's business operations team and reports to the Director of Finance and Analysis. Advancement is responsible for communications and marketing, engagement, and fundraising initiatives.
This position will coordinate the division's contracts and procurement processes as well as monitor and evaluate business and cross functional activities across the Advancement Division, Virginia Tech Foundation, and Virginia Tech to support the organization and adhere to policies and procedures. This position requires the ability to interact with Advancement, Virginia Tech, and Virginia Tech Foundation employees at all levels with an understanding of protocol and confidentiality.
The ideal candidate would possess strong interpersonal and communication skills with the ability to effectively communicate complex compliance and financial information to a variety of audiences with a demonstrated understanding of contracting procedures, procurement methodologies, and financial regulatory requirements.
Key duties will include but are not limited to:
• Oversee and coordinate the entire contracts process for the division, ensuring compliance with state and Virginia Tech Foundation guidelines.
• Maintains archives of all Advancement Division contracts, serves as the division liaison, and manages relationships with university and Virginia Tech Foundation legal departments and with the university's Procurement, Information Technology Procurement and Licensing and Information Technology Security departments.
• Maintain a comprehensive database, coordinate, and track audit follow-up for the division's departments, ensuring adherence to institutional policies, financial standards, and regulatory requirements
• Oversee PCI-DSS compliance efforts, ensuring all payment card processing activities meet the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ard (PCI DSS) requirements and safeguarding sensitive financial information.

About Virginia Tech
Dedicated to its motto, Ut Prosim (That I May Serve), Virginia Tech pushes the boundaries of knowledge by taking a hands-on, transdisciplinary approach to preparing scholars to be leaders and problem-solvers. A comprehensive land-grant institution that enhances the quality of life in Virginia and throughout the world, Virginia Tech is an inclusive community dedicated to knowledge, discovery, and creativity. The university offers more than 280 majors to a diverse enrollment of more than 36,000 undergraduate, graduate, and professional students in eight undergraduate colleges , a school of medicine , a veterinary medicine college, Graduate School , and Honors College . The university has a significant presence across Virginia, including the Innovation Campus in Northern Virginia; the Health Sciences and Technology Campus in Roanoke; sites in Newport News and Richmond; and numerous Extension offices and research centers . A leading global research institution, Virginia Tech conducts more than $500 million in research annually.
